NMR study of Si-substitution effect for Al in PrTi _2 Al _20

We present the results of ^27 Al-nuclear magnetic resonance (NMR) studies of Si-substituted PrTi _2 Al _20 in order to clarify the magnetic and electronic properties at low temperatures and the change by Si substitution for Al from a microscopic point of view. From the analyses of the Knight shift, the hyperfine coupling constants on ^27 Al in PrTi _2 (Si _0.1 Al _0.9 ) _20 are slightly larger than those of PrTi _2 Al _20 . The nuclear spin-lattice relaxation rate 1/T_1 does not exhibit any anomaly around 2.0 K, in contrast to the results associated with the quadrupolar ordering in PrTi _2 Al _20 . The analysis of 1/T_1 at high temperatures reveals that the c – f hybridization may be reduced by Si substitution for Al.
